Aller au contenu
Forums Tennis-Classim

Paul91Essonne

Membre
  • Compteur de contenus

    160
  • Inscription

  • Dernière visite

Messages posté(e)s par Paul91Essonne


  1. Pourquoi est ce que sur Ten’Up je vois plein de tournoi qui sont en cours ou alors qui débute vers le 20 juin ou même en juillet ? Simple oubli des J-A ? Comment ça se passe avec ceux qui proposent les paiements en ligne ? Ils remboursent ou bien ils oublient aussi lol ?

    Ca ne serait pas plus simple de juste retirer les tournois qui n’auront ou qui n’ont pas lieu ?


  2. Il y a 2 heures, Nicolas a dit :

    Actuellement l'outil récupère la page de simulation de classement pour chaque joueur, pas la page de palmarès. C'est parce que la page de simulation inclut plus d'informations utiles, en particulier pour les joueurs anonymes.

    Le problème pour le double est que le paramètre partenaire_double=true ne fonctionne que sur la page de palmarès et pas sur la page de simulation. Donc si on veut récupérer ces résultats, ça fait une 2ème requête par joueur. Une solution possible serait de donner la possibilité de le faire, mais en option.

    Pour ce qui est de la profondeur des calculs pour les joueurs de double, je pense que ça ne vaut pas le coup d'appliquer la même. Il vaut  probablement mieux rester en P0 ou éventuellement P1 pour ceux-là.

    Ah oui tout a fait. Dans ce cas là on pourrait attendre que la simulation sur mobile soit dispo (en espérant qu'ils incluent le calcul des doubles) et comme ça on aura accès a une toute nouvelle API et beaucoup plus clean surtout qui propose la simu des doubles également. 


  3. il y a une heure, trollix a dit :

    Même si on fait pas 2 requêtes par joueur (effectivement GET partenaire_double=true  ça peut le faire), faudra requêter en profondeur cible pour chacun des 3 autres joueurs de double. Et ça , ça va coûter cher en requêtes..

    Non mais justement, on pourra juste calculer le nb de pts sans forcément simuler en prenant juste le classement actuel... Car effectivement ça fera pas mal de requests. Pour la plus part d'entre nous ça représente max 10 pts ... Donc pas grand chose en soit.

    Ou sinon comme dit plus haut, entrer le nb de points manuellement pourrait être une solution aussi.

    Ou sinon demander à l'utilisateur si il veut calculer automatiquement ou non les points de double.

     

    Si oui: on fait la requête avec partenaire_double=true

    Sinon: on demande au user le nombre de points de double qu'il possède OU on ne calcule pas les doubles cad partenaire_double=false


  4. Le 06/09/2019 à 20:13, Nicolas a dit :

    Pour l'ajout des matchs de double il y a un truc emmerdant c'est que la page de simulation de classement ne les inclut pas. Je n'ai pas très envie de devoir faire 2 requêtes HTTP par joueur...

    Comment ça deux requêtes ? J'ai pas vraiment regarder les requêtes que le script faisait mais juste en ajoutant en GET partenaire_double=true pour moi ça affiche bien les doubles sans faire 2 requêtes. Y a un truc que j'ai sûrement pas du comprendre :D


  5. Je passe enfin 15/5 ;) l'année dernière durant mon passage adulte j'ai un peu ramé et du coup je m'étais maintenu à 30/1. Mais cette année en enchaînant les tournois j'ai eu un petit déclic et j'ai pris 2 classements en 2 mois. Je sens que je peux les faire chier maintenant et que je suis au niveau donc c'est cool ;)

    J'espère pouvoir monter 15/4 cette année (déjà 2 15/4 pour la nouvelle saison, ca commence bien) voire 15/3 sur un malentendu :D

    • Like 1

  6. Oui effectivement pas bien vu par les JA d'annuler sans avoir payer et la plupart d'entre eux te mettent sur liste d'attente (pour te faire ch***) sur tous les tournois qu'ils font après ça, ou trouve le moyen de te mettre contre un gros joueur au premier tour. Mais bon ça se comprend aussi de notre côté c'est vrai que payer 20balles pour au final ne rien faire c'est pas ouf, mais du leur aussi, se faire chier à faire un tableau pour qu'au final ça fasse un trou dedans car Monsieur s'est désisté au dernier moment c'est pas fou non plus...

    Dans tt les cas c'est chiant et je vois pas vraiment comment on pourrait lutter contre ça....


  7. il y a 5 minutes, dhrou a dit :

    Ce soir je vois tous les anonymes ont le classement NC ! Pas très pratique pour les simulations de classement... J'ai pas l'impression que c'était le cas il y a deux semaines.

    Je rêve ? 

    David

    Ah oui effectivement tu as bien raison, c'est pareil pour moi.

    Espérons que ce soit réparer pour le classement final 😅😅


  8. il y a 17 minutes, Serafel a dit :

    Certes mais est ce vraiment nécessaire d'envoyer une simulation extrêmement gourmande côté serveur pour savoir s'il te manque 3 points ou si tu en as 2 de trop ? Pour moi ca reste un outil, mais mal utilisé ça peut vite se transformer en pourissage de tenup. Je n'ai pas idée des chiffres, mais vous pensez que le serveur craque à combien de simulations simultanées en profondeur 5 ? emoji38.png

    Envoyé de mon Redmi Note 5 en utilisant Tapatalk
     

    T'inquiète pas pour ça va, si comme tu dis "ça pourriser leurs serveurs" il te bannisserait bien avant, genre profondeur 2.

    C'est obligé qu'un gars de la FFT soit au courant de cet outil et si ils ne font rien contre c'est qu'il n'y a pas de pb pour eux...


  9. Il y a 3 heures, Nicolas a dit :

    Oui il y a 4 tentatives pour récupérer chaque palmarès. Si certains n’ont pas pu être récupérés après les 4 tentatives il y a un message qui est affiché pour le signaler.

    Je ferai quand même une correction pour mieux prendre en compte ce cas (c’est un problème spécifique à la version Requests).

    Tu peux changer le timeout en ajoutant l'argument " timeout=(temps en seconde) " dans la requête request. Je sais pas si ça changerait qq chose.


  10. il y a 48 minutes, Nicolas a dit :

    @Yusuke118 merci pour les infos. Effectivement retirer les accents permet d'éliminer les erreurs d'encodage en pratique mais je pense que la meilleure solution est de passer à une gestion plus saine de unicode/bytes, ce que Python 2 permet très difficilement.

    Du coup j'en profite pour proposer cette version de test basée sur Python 3 : https://github.com/coti/classement/archive/python3.zip
    À part la migration Python 3 c'est la version requests. J'ai fait quelques changements dessus récemment. Voir ici les derniers commits : https://github.com/coti/classement/commits/python3

    Merci à @ggman23 pour avoir signalé le bug sur la normalisation des classements "Top XX".

    Les changements de code pour Python 2 sont visibles ici : https://github.com/coti/classement/commit/1634ca7b757ca3cae0ccb2417fe9ecd77cede8da

     

    J'ai seulement un Mac mais je suis en train de m'installer une VM Windows. Je vais essayer de faire un exe avec.

    Windows n'est même pas nécessaire avec pyinstaller il me semble, il faut juste l'installer avec pip. Tu pourrais très bien build sous mac si je ne me trompe pas


  11. Il y a 2 heures, nat54 a dit :

    Qu'est ce qui ne fonctionne pas ?
    Je viens de lancer, l'onglet compétition et ça me donne 3 tournois padel à venir dans le coin.

    Par contre la réservation sur le site ne fonctionne toujours pas (là où l'on peut voir les autres réservants).

    Oui moi aussi aucun pb de connexion seulement impossible de voir le palmarès 2019 alors que il y a 2/3 semaines c'était possible.

    Concernant la réservation mon club ne l'a pas activé donc impossible de t'aider

×